v2.4.0 — Rotated the signing key for Quillhopper, our queue-depth autoscaler. The old key was nearing its two-year mark and honestly nobody remembered provisioning it, so we cut a fresh one. Scaling policies signed with the old key stop validating after the next minor release, so re-sign anything you've got stashed in staging. No behavior changes to the scaler itself. For future maintainers wondering which key is current: it's the one below.

rollout seal: bky4_x7Gc

Test Plan Note — Calendar Sync Conflict (Tindervale Scheduler)

Scenario: two clients edit the same event offline, then sync. Expected behavior: the Larkmoor merge service keeps the later timestamp and files a conflict record. Verify the losing edit appears in the conflicts pane and no duplicate events are created. Run against the staging tenant only. Authenticate your test client to the sync endpoint using the bearer token below.

bearer token for hagug-kawip: eyJhbGciOiJIUzI1NiIsInR5cCI6IkpXVCJ9.eyJzdWIiOiIydxNAjDeTmIn0.L86yxoGFcrhy

## Service Account: sweeper-bot

The orphaned-resource sweeper (aka "Tidywolf") runs nightly and deletes volumes, snapshots, and stale DNS entries nobody claims within 14 days. It runs as the sweeper-bot service account, which only has destroy rights in the scratch and staging tiers — prod is off-limits, don't worry. If you need to run a manual sweep before a release cut, authenticate with the key below.

API key for fawep-kahog: vxb15-oGAHe8SEMmJYYhd

Migration Step 4: Enable Offline Mode (Fernhollow Surveyor)

Upgrade clients to 3.2 before flipping the flag. Offline capture queues survey entries locally and syncs when connectivity returns; conflict resolution is last-write-wins per field. Purge stale local caches first or sync will reject mixed-schema batches. Roll out region by region. Apply the following configuration to each deployment.

deployment values, hawep-hawep:
RALAX_PIN=0900
RALAX_TENANT=sildor
RALAX_METRICS_HOST=metrics.ralax.xolmardata.example
RALAX_SEAL=seal_87e42d77
RALAX_STANDBY_TEAM=briius